We are seeking an experienced Change Management Specialist to manage the change office for large, strategic customers. This role acts as a single point of contact, coordinating and managing all contractual and commercial changes for high-value accounts. The position plays a critical role in ensuring change requests are accurately assessed, approved, implemented and delivered in line with agreed service levels, while maintaining strong collaboration with customers and internal stakeholders.
Job Responsibility
Manage end-to-end change control activities, including request intake, analysis, approval, implementation, reporting and review
Coordinate and progress customer change requests through defined change management processes, including escalation where required
Maintain accurate and up-to-date records within the change management system
Provide timely, high-quality reporting and clear communication on change status, impacts and outcomes
Deliver detailed impact assessments for contractual and commercial changes
Manage smaller-scale commercial changes, including impact assessments and contract amendments
Organise and lead meetings and calls with customers and internal stakeholders, including senior leadership
Ensure appropriate approvals are secured prior to implementation and that changes are owned and delivered within agreed SLAs
Review completed changes to confirm objectives have been achieved and best practices are applied.
